Abstract

A new type of amino-protecting group is described in which a Michael acceptor is incorporated into the protectant so that treatment with a nucleophile will trigger deblocking. Comparison of various Michael acceptors showed that for several key electron-withdrawing groups, the order of reactivity was C6H5SO2> Me3CSO2> COOEt> C6H5SO> C6H4NO2-p.
